The core mission of a Mechanical Machine Design Engineer is to conceive, design, develop, and refine mechanical systems and machinery. This involves a comprehensive process beginning with understanding operational requirements and constraints. Typical responsibilities include creating detailed 3D models and engineering drawings using advanced CAD software like SolidWorks, AutoCAD, or Creo. Engineers perform rigorous calculations for stress, fatigue, thermal properties, and dynamics to ensure safety, reliability, and performance. They select appropriate materials, components (such as bearings, motors, and actuators), and manufacturing processes, considering factors like cost, durability, and ease of assembly. Prototyping, testing, and iterative refinement are central to the role, as is collaborating closely with cross-functional teams including manufacturing engineers, project managers, and technicians to guide a design from the drawing board to the factory floor. Common responsibilities for those in Mechanical Machine Design Engineer jobs also encompass designing for manufacturability and assembly (DFMA), ensuring designs can be produced efficiently. They often develop documentation packages, including bills of materials (BOMs), assembly instructions, and maintenance manuals. Troubleshooting existing equipment, leading redesigns for improvement, and staying abreast of emerging technologies like additive manufacturing or advanced robotics are also key aspects of the profession. The role demands a proactive approach to problem-solving, often requiring innovative solutions to complex mechanical challenges. Typical skills and requirements for success in these jobs are both technical and interpersonal. A bachelor’s degree in mechanical engineering or a closely related field is standard. Proficiency in 3D CAD modeling and simulation tools is essential, alongside a strong foundational knowledge of core mechanical engineering principles: mechanics of materials, thermodynamics, fluid dynamics, and machine design. Familiarity with manufacturing processes (machining, welding, sheet metal fabrication) and industry standards (ANSI, ISO, ASME) is crucial. Beyond technical acumen, successful designers exhibit excellent analytical and organizational skills, the ability to manage multiple projects, and outstanding communication skills to articulate design concepts and collaborate effectively.
